MacDonald-Cartier Freeway (John A. MacDonald, George-Etienne Cartier) ===================================== You might be surprised to learn that the Macdonald-Cartier Freeway is not part of the Trans-Canada Highway. The highway was so named to honour the two major founding fathers of Confederation and to promote national unity. P.S. There's no capital 'd' in Macdonald. And there is a hyphen in Trans-Canada.
